guys, if I want to upgrade the HDD in my PS4, is it a regular 2.5" SATA?

and what happened to all my saved games and install? Do I need to do them all over again, as in put all my discs back in?

You can use an external USB drive to backup all the existing saves, downloads, and game data etc, be warned its slow...

And long as the new drive is not over 2 tb ( as larger drives don't play well with rest mode etc ) and is 9.5mm or thinner and a ssta 2.5 " then you're good to go..
